关闭火狐浏览器媒体控制系统集成有四种方法:一、about:config设media.hardwaremediakeys.enabled为false;二、组策略启用“禁用硬件媒体键处理”;三、user.js文件固化配置;四、卸载或禁用相关扩展。
如果您在使用火狐浏览器时按下键盘上的播放/暂停、音量调节等媒体控制键,Windows 快速设置面板或锁屏界面中随即弹出媒体控制叠加层(OSD),该行为源于 Firefox 主动向操作系统注册媒体会话并暴露硬件媒体键处理能力。以下是关闭此 Windows 系统级集成的多种独立可行路径:
此方法直接关闭 Firefox 向 Windows 操作系统通告媒体会话的能力,从而阻止快速设置、锁屏界面及系统级音量 OSD 的生成与显示,效果覆盖所有网页和媒体场景,且无需第三方组件参与。
1、在 Firefox 地址栏中输入 about:config 并按回车键。
2、在弹出的风险提示页面中点击 “接受风险并继续”。
3、在搜索框中输入 media.hardwaremediakeys.enabled。
4、双击该项,将其布尔值由 true 修改为 false。
5、关闭并重新启动 Firefox 浏览器。
该方式在系统策略层面锁定配置,防止用户或自动更新导致的设置回退,适用于多用户环境或需统一管理的组织终端,对所有 Firefox 实例生效且不依赖 about:config 访问权限。
1、按下 Win + R,输入 gpedit.msc 并回车。
2、依次展开:计算机配置 → 管理模板 → Mozilla → Firefox。
3、双击右侧的 “禁用硬件媒体键处理” 策略。
4、选择 “已启用”,点击确定。
5、以管理员身份打开命令提示符,运行 gpupdate /force 刷新组策略。
6、重启 Firefox。
user.js 文件在每次 Firefox 启动时强制重载指定偏好项,其优先级高于首选项数据库,可有效抵御配置被重置、Profile 损坏或版本升级引发的 media.hardwaremediakeys.enabled 自动恢复为 true 的问题。
1、完全关闭 Firefox 浏览器。
2、进入 Firefox 配置文件夹,路径通常为:%APPDATA%MozillaFirefoxProfiles*.default-release。
3、新建一个纯文本文件,命名为 user.js(注意无 .txt 扩展名)。
4、用记事本打开该文件,写入以下内容:user_pref("media.hardwaremediakeys.enabled", false);。
5、保存文件,确保编码为 UTF-8 无 BOM。
6、重新启动 Firefox。
部分扩展(如 Web Media Controller、Media Keys Enabler、Global Media Controls)会主动调用 Media Session API 或劫持硬件按键事件,绕过 Firefox 原生配置,导致即使 media.hardwaremediakeys.enabled 为 false,OSD 仍可能由扩展自身触发。
1、点击 Firefox 右上角三条横线菜单,选择 “扩展和主题”。
2、在已安装扩展列表中查找名称含 “media”、“control”、“session”、“key” 的项目。
3、对疑似扩展逐个执行 “移除” 或点击齿轮图标选择 “禁用”。
4、每禁用一项后,重启 Firefox 并测试媒体键是否仍触发 OSD。
5、确认问题消失后,保留其余必要扩展,仅移除被验证为干扰源的项目。